Description

A collection of decorative ceramic items in the Chinese style, comprising a pair of lidded porcelain jars and a pair of glazed guardian lion figures. The porcelain jars are of baluster form with matching domed covers, decorated in underglaze blue with bird motifs, resembling cranes or herons, amongst flowering peonies and foliage. The decoration is accented with a key-fret border to the shoulder and lid rim, and a stylised petal border to the base. One jar features an illegible blue underglaze circular mark to the body and handwritten numerals 9, 3, 1, 2 in black ink to the lid. The guardian lion (foo dog) figures are finished in a monochrome turquoise glaze, modelled in traditional seated poses upon rectangular plinths with openwork geometric cut-outs. These items are consistent with 20th-century production for the decorative market.
Dimensions: Lidded jars stand approximately 25cm to 30cm in height.
